Compensation payouts to UK rail passengers for delays hit £100m a year
via theguardian.comRecord sum follows almost 320,000 train services being cancelled or part cancelled in past year in BritainBusiness live – latest updatesCompensation paid to passengers for train delays in Britain has reached record levels, with annual payouts surpassing £100m and the number of claims for delayed or cancelled trains continuing to grow.Payouts to passengers for disrupted journeys reached £101.3m in the year to April 2023 – up by 155% from £39m in 2021-22. Post Office chief Nick Read cleared of misconduct in separate inquiry
via theguardian.comExistence of whistleblower allegations added to scandal over Horizon computer systemThe Post Office has said that its chief executive, Nick Read, has been cleared of any wrongdoing in an investigation after the existence of whistleblower allegations was dramatically revealed in parliament.Read has been “exonerated of all the misconduct allegations” brought by a whistleblower after an investigation by an external barrister. Taylor Swift fans given ‘urgent warning’ as £1m lost in ticket scams
via theguardian.comLloyds Bank says more than 600 of its customers have been tricked by fraudsters so farA rise in fraud cases involving Taylor Swift fans desperate to buy tickets to her sold-out UK shows has prompted Lloyds Bank to issue an “urgent warning” after more than 600 of its customers were scammed.With the superstar due to arrive in Europe next month, the high street bank said its data suggested that UK fans had lost more than £1m to fraudsters so far. Royal Mail owner received takeover offer from Czech billionaire
via theguardian.comIDS shares rise as it is reported it rejected bid from Daniel Křetínský’s EP GroupBusiness live – latest updatesThe owner of Royal Mail received a takeover offer from a Czech billionaire who has stakes in Sainsbury’s and West Ham United football club.Daniel Křetínský approached International Distributions Services (IDS), the owner of the struggling British postal company, this month. Moment spire collapses at Copenhagen's old stock exchange – video
via theguardian.comA fire has broken out at Copenhagen’s old stock exchange, one of the Danish capital’s most famous buildings, engulfing its spire, which collapsed on to the roof. There were no reports of injuries. The historic building, whose spire is shaped as the tails of four dragons entwined, had been under renovation when the blaze broke out. The Dutch Renaissance-style building no longer houses the Danish stock exchange but serves as headquarters for the Danish Chamber of CommerceSpire collapse
